How to Start a Data Science Online Course with No Experience
Starting a career in data science without prior experience might seem daunting initially, but it’s entirely achievable with dedication, a structured approach, and the right resources. Data science has rapidly become one of the most sought-after professions worldwide, and India is no exception.
From improving business decisions to advancing healthcare, data science course skills are transforming industries at an unprecedented pace. This guide will walk you through how to begin learning data science online, even if you are starting from scratch.
Understanding the Basics of Data Science
Before jumping into the technical side, it’s important to first understand what data science really is and why it matters. Data science involves extracting meaningful insights from raw data using a combination of statistics, programming, and domain knowledge. It helps organizations predict trends, optimize processes, and make data-driven decisions. This multidisciplinary nature means data scientists must have a solid grasp of both analytical thinking and technical tools.
Understanding the significance of data science in various industries will keep you motivated throughout your learning journey. For more detailed information, you can explore credible resources like Wikipedia’s page on Data Science.
Building a Strong Foundation in Mathematics
Math is the backbone of data science. Although you don’t need to be a mathematician, understanding key concepts in statistics and linear algebra is essential. Statistics helps you make sense of data through concepts like mean, median, probability, and distributions. Linear algebra, including matrices and vectors, is fundamental for many machine learning algorithms.
If you feel rusty in math, don’t worry. Platforms like Khan Academy offer free, beginner-friendly courses to help refresh your knowledge at your own pace. Having a solid foundation here will make subsequent topics easier to grasp.
Learning Python Programming
Programming is an indispensable skill for data scientists, and Python is the most popular language for beginners. Python’s simple syntax and powerful libraries make it an excellent choice for data manipulation, visualization, and modeling.
Begin with basic programming concepts like variables, loops, and functions. Then, move on to libraries such as NumPy for numerical operations, Pandas for data handling, Matplotlib and Seaborn for visualization, and Scikit-learn for implementing machine learning models. Interactive platforms like Codecademy and DataCamp offer hands-on Python courses tailored for data science beginners.
Selecting the Right Online Learning Platform
Choosing a credible online course is crucial to ensure structured learning. Reputed platforms such as Coursera, edX, DataCamp, and Udemy provide beginner-friendly courses designed by universities and industry experts. These courses typically offer video lectures, quizzes, hands-on projects, and community forums.
When selecting a course, look for features like project-based learning, mentorship support, and certification options. Investing in a well-structured paid course can provide a more guided learning experience, but many free resources are also available to start with.
Following a Structured Learning Path
To avoid feeling overwhelmed, follow a step-by-step learning path. Start with an overview of data science fundamentals, then move into Python programming, followed by statistics, data analysis, visualization, and introductory machine learning.
This incremental approach ensures you build competence and confidence gradually. Many online courses are designed with this progression in mind, helping you cover each topic comprehensively before moving on.
Applying Knowledge Through Hands-On Projects
Theory alone is not enough. Practical application through projects is where real learning happens. Start with simple datasets to perform exploratory data analysis, visualize trends, or build basic predictive models. As you grow more confident, take on complex datasets and problems to sharpen your skills.
Websites like Kaggle offer a wide range of datasets and competitions where beginners can practice and learn from the community. Building a portfolio of projects not only reinforces your knowledge but also serves as evidence of your skills to potential employers.
Engaging with the Data Science Community
Joining data science forums and communities can enhance your learning experience. Platforms like Reddit’s r/datascience, Stack Overflow, LinkedIn groups, and Medium’s “Towards Data Science” provide opportunities to ask questions, share knowledge, and network with professionals.
Active participation keeps you motivated, exposes you to different perspectives, and helps you stay updated on industry trends and emerging tools.
Building a Portfolio and Showcasing Your Work
Creating a portfolio is critical for job seekers. Host your code on GitHub and write detailed descriptions of your projects on platforms like Medium or personal blogs. Each project should explain the problem, your approach, results, and conclusions.
A well-maintained portfolio demonstrates your practical skills and commitment, often making a stronger impression than certificates alone.
Considering Certifications and Career Progression
After acquiring foundational skills and practical experience, consider earning certifications to enhance your credibility. Professional certificates from IBM, Google, and Microsoft can boost your profile and improve job prospects.
As you grow, explore specialization areas such as machine learning engineering, data engineering, or business intelligence. Continuous learning and adaptation to new technologies will keep you relevant in this rapidly evolving field.
Conclusion
Starting a data science course online with no experience is entirely feasible with patience, perseverance, and the right strategy. By understanding the fundamentals, developing programming skills, applying your knowledge through projects, and engaging with the community, you set yourself up for success.
Remember, every expert was once a beginner. Take one step at a time, stay consistent, and gradually you will build the expertise needed to excel in this exciting career.

Comments
Post a Comment